更改调试项目选项对话框中的工作目录会导致在“项目用户选项文件”中添加一个条目。此文件未“签入”到我们的源代码控制存储库,因为它应该是特定于用户的。我需要更改调试工作目录选项的默认设置,以便签出此项目的用户不必在启动调试器之前不断更改它。
我曾认为将生成的设置条目从“项目用户选项文件”移动到“项目文件”就足够了。它确实有效 - 就像在默认工作目录更改中一样 - 但是我无法再从 VS 内部调试项目。尝试运行调试器时,我得到的只是一个对话框,提示 VS 无法启动调试器。(查看调试设置,它们似乎很好并且没有改变)。
那么为VS项目设置默认调试工作目录的正确方法是什么?
注意:仅当您将设置条目从用户选项文件“移动”到项目文件时,才会出现该对话框。如果您只是复制条目 - 以便它在两个文件中 - 运行调试器没有问题。不幸的是,这再次意味着用户仍然必须手动添加设置。